ZIP 48034 and ZIP 48040 are ZIP Code areas in Michigan. This page compares them across population, income, housing, education, commuting, and how each has changed since 2019.

ZIP 48034 has the higher population (15,213 vs 9,942 in ZIP 48040). ZIP 48040 has the higher median household income ($69,661 vs $59,634 in ZIP 48034). ZIP 48034 has the higher median home value ($259,400 vs $185,500 in ZIP 48040).
